HOFT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2022 in Review
73 of the 5,805 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Hooker Furnishings Corp (HOFT) for Q3 2022, worth a combined $109M — down 23% from $142M a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 19 funds closed out of HOFT and 8 opened new positions — a net loss of 11 holders — while 27 trimmed existing stakes and 22 added.
The largest buyer was Pzena Investment Management, adding an estimated $2.19M. The largest seller was Towle & Co, exiting entirely with an estimated $10M sold.
